The status of your application can be checked by visiting Beaufort County Property Records and searching for your property. Buying real estate and moving to South Carolina? You may be eligible for the 4% Special Legal Residency Assessment Ratio. And if you`ve been a South Carolina resident for at least a year, you may also qualify for the Homestead exemption. Active military personnel or veterans may also be eligible for tax relief. If South Carolina is your new permanent resident, you must apply for “Homestead” status, also known as the 4% Special Assessment Legal Residency Application, no later than January 15 of the year following the purchase of your home. If you do not submit this review on time or if you are not eligible for this review, you will pay with a 6% evaluation rate. Since 2014, legal residents can also rent their property for up to 72 days while being eligible for the 4% quota. Or, if you plan to live in your home and rent fewer than 6 bedrooms or ancillary apartments on your property, you are still eligible for the 4% quota. One hundred percent (100%) of the market value of an owner-occupied residential property that receives the 4% special assessment rate is also automatically exempt from all property taxes levied for school operations. To qualify for this 4% lower rating, you must have changed your driver`s license and voter registration in your previous state and completed the South Carolina State Income Tax form by that date. Military personnel and veterans must present their official military identity card.

and may contact the Office of the Beaufort County Auditor at 843-255-2500 to request special assessments and exemptions. The Homestead Exemption Credit exempts all remaining taxes on the first value of $50,000 for all purposes except school operating taxes (which are already exempt as described above). To qualify for the family property exemption, you have a simple and complete right to your principal residence or estate at your principal residence, or you are the beneficiary of a trust that owns your principal residence. If your mortgage is in escrow, once taxes are updated, send a copy of the corrected invoice to your mortgage company`s escrow department so they can update their records. Homestead exemptions can be filed with your county auditor`s office. Some common documents used as proof of eligibility include: a birth certificate or a South Carolina driver`s license when applying for age. They will need documents from the state or federal agency certifying the disability if they are disabled. If you have not been classified by one of the agencies, you can contact the State Agency for Vocational Rehabilitation. If you are applying because of blindness, you must provide documentation from a licensed ophthalmologist.
